For anyone following my progress, I have now installed the UN52E Botom Bracket, front derailleur,XTrear cassette, XTcranks, Crank Bros Egg Beater pedals, and crank bolts. I installed the shifter cables a few nights ago. I am 1 chain, 1 pair of grips, and a front brake short of a complete bike. according to my wife's bathroom scale, it's weighing in at 24.5 lbs. I'm debating on whether to slurge on some ergon grips for comfort, or just buy some comfortable Oury's in a cool colour for 1/3 of the price.  I am also wondering about the usefulness of bar ends on a bike like this.
